Unlocking Success Through Networking: 

10 Tips for Building Meaningful Connections

Networking is more than just exchanging business cards or connecting on LinkedIn. It’s about building genuine relationships, fostering collaborations, and unlocking new opportunities. Whether you’re a seasoned professional or just starting your career, effective networking can propel you towards your goals and aspirations. Here are 10 tips to help you navigate the world of networking and forge meaningful connections:

1. Set Clear Goals:

Before diving into networking events or meetings, take some time to define your objectives. Whether it’s expanding your client base, seeking career advice, or exploring new opportunities, having clear goals will guide your interactions and conversations.

2. Be Authentic:

Authenticity is key to building trust and rapport with others. Be genuine in your interactions, share your experiences and insights, and show a sincere interest in learning from others.

3. Listen Actively:

Effective networking is not just about talking but also about listening. Practice active listening by paying attention to what others are saying, asking thoughtful questions, and showing genuine interest in their perspectives.

4. Offer Value:

Seek ways to provide value to your network. Share relevant resources, offer assistance or support, and make introductions to help others achieve their goals. By giving before you receive, you’ll build stronger and more meaningful connections.

5. Follow Up:

After networking events or meetings, take the initiative to follow up with new contacts. Send a personalized message expressing your appreciation for the conversation and your interest in staying connected. Follow-up is essential for nurturing relationships and keeping the connection alive.

6. Attend Events:

Actively participate in networking events, industry conferences, and workshops to expand your network and meet like-minded professionals. Don’t be afraid to step out of your comfort zone and introduce yourself to new people.

7. Utilize Online Platforms:

In today’s digital age, social media platforms like LinkedIn offer valuable opportunities for networking. Join relevant groups, participate in discussions, and connect with professionals in your industry. Leverage online platforms to showcase your expertise and expand your reach.

8. Be Prepared:

Before attending networking events, do your homework. Research the attendees, familiarize yourself with the topics of discussion, and prepare your elevator pitch. Being well-prepared will boost your confidence and make you stand out in conversations.

9. Practice Elevator Pitch:

Craft a concise and compelling elevator pitch that introduces yourself and your work. Your elevator pitch should highlight your unique value proposition and leave a memorable impression on others.

10. Be Proactive:

Don’t wait for opportunities to come to you. Take the initiative to reach out to potential collaborators, mentors, or industry leaders within your network. Be proactive in seeking out new connections and exploring potential synergies.

In conclusion, effective networking is a powerful tool for advancing your career, growing your business, and achieving your goals. By following these 10 tips, you’ll be well-equipped to navigate the world of networking with confidence and purpose. Remember, networking is not just about what you can get, but also about what you can give. So go out there, build meaningful connections, and unlock new opportunities on your journey to success.
